Technique Appropriate Food Storage Space



Correctly keeping food is crucial in protecting against parasite problems. Keep all food things in secured containers to deny parasites very easy access. See to it to store dry goods like grains and cereals in airtight containers to discourage pantry insects like weevils and beetles.

Avoid leaving food out on countertops or tables, as this can attract ants, flies, and various other parasites. In the fridge, shop fruits and vegetables in the crisper cabinet and maintain all leftovers in securely sealed containers to prevent smells from enticing bugs. Consistently check for any type of indications of food wasting and without delay dispose of any kind of products that have gone bad.



In addition, do not ignore animal food-- shop it in impermeable containers also. By exercising appropriate food storage behaviors, you can considerably minimize the risk of drawing in bugs right into your home and prevent future problems.

Maintain Tidiness and Health



Maintaining your space tidy and preserving excellent hygiene methods are important action in avoiding bug infestations. Consistently vacuuming and mopping floorings, cleaning down counters, and quickly cleaning up spills are crucial routines to take on. Mess supplies hiding areas for pests, so decluttering your home can aid eliminate prospective hiding areas. Ensure to seal up splits and crevices where pests can enter, such as around pipes and windows. In addition, appropriate waste management is crucial-- get rid of trash on a regular basis and maintain trash can sealed tightly.

In the kitchen, shop food in closed containers and quickly clean recipes to prevent drawing in bugs. On a regular basis clean home appliances like toaster ovens and microwaves to get rid of food crumbs and spills. Take notice of animal food too; shop it in secured containers and don't leave it out overnight. Great personal health is also essential - tidy up after meals, take out the garbage frequently, and preserve a tidy living setting. By including these sanitation and health methods into your regimen, you can help avoid future insect problems.
